目录建表语句数据类型表的分类分类内部表和外部表区别示例内部表基本操作知识点示例外部表基本操作示例查看/修改表知识点示例默认分隔符示例快速映射表知识示例数据导入和导出文件数据加载导入直接上传文件window页面上传linux本地put上传load加载文件 load移动HDFS文件load上传Linux文件insert插入数据insert覆盖数据文件数据导出直接下载文件web页面下载编辑ge
一、数据库建模二、建表三、数据库字典四、DML语句五、视图六、索引七、序列八、DDL语句 Lesson 8 Overview of Data Modeling and Database Design----------------------------------------------------------------------------- 数据库建模E-R图Entity 实体
explain或desc显示了mysql如何使用索引来处理select语句以及连接表。可以帮助选择更好的索引和写出更优化的查询语句。explain 数据表 或 desc 数据表显示数据表各字段含义explain sql 或desc sql显示sql执行效率使用方法,在select语句前加上explain就可以了,如:explain select * from statuses_status whe
1/专有名词关系数据库(Relational Database,RDB)关系数据库是现在应用最广泛的数据库。关系数据库在 1969 年诞生,可谓历史悠久。和 Excel 工作表一样,它也采用由行和列组成的二维表来管理数据,所以简单易懂。同时,它还使用专门的 SQL(Structured Query Language,结构化查询语言)对数据进行操作。DDL(Data Definitio
hive的查询语法(DQL)全局排序order by 会对输入做全局排序,因此只有一个reducer,会导致当输入规模较大时,需要较长的计算时间使用 order by子句排序 :ASC(ascend)升序(默认)| DESC(descend)降序order by放在select语句的结尾局部排序sort by 不是全局排序,其在数据进入reducer前完成排序。如果用sort by进行排序,并且设
查看表结构
查看表结构是指:查看数据库中已经存在的表的定义
1、查看表基本结构的语句:describe
describe语句可以查看表的基本定义:其中包括字段名、字段数据类型、是否为主键和默认值等;
describe语句的语法格式如下: describe 表名;
describe可以缩写为desc: desc 表名;
2、查看表的详细结构语句show c
MySQL50道题 数据表介绍 –1.学生表 Student(SId,Sname,Sage,Ssex) –SId 学生编号,Sname 学生姓名,Sage 出生年月,Ssex 学生性别 –2.课程表 Course(CId,Cname,TId) –CId 课程编号,Cname 课程名称,TId 教师编号 –3.教师表 Teacher(TId,Tname) –TId 教师编号,Tname 教师姓名 –
转载
2023-10-11 15:00:10
93阅读
---------------ECS Linux 系统中的 MySQL 进行备份导出的命令是什么,阿里云虚拟机数据库。在阿里云ecs云服务器上部署数据库后,在平常的操作中可能会遇到些问题,可以先做个大致的了解:如果您想看更多的在ecs上的数据库的相关操作,请前往以下两个帮助页面查看:1、ESC数据库密码忘了怎么查看修改?以常用的mysqld数据库为例:首先vim /etc/my.cnf在[mysq
查看表结构语法:desc 表名;
原创
2023-02-13 10:21:14
419阅读
# 多个表的Hive表描述
在Hive中,我们经常会遇到需要管理多个表的情况。当我们需要查看多个表的结构信息时,通过使用`DESCRIBE TABLE`命令可以方便地查看表的结构信息。在本文中,我们将介绍如何在Hive中描述多个表的方法,并通过代码示例展示实际操作过程。
## Hive中描述表的方法
在Hive中,我们可以使用`DESCRIBE TABLE`命令来查看表的结构信息,包括表的列
SQL学习 — DQL — 排序查询3. 排序查询/*
语法:
select 查询字段
from 表名
【where 筛选条件】
order by 排序字段 【asc | desc】
特点:
1. asc代表升序,desc代表降序
如果不写,默认升序
2. 排序字段除了可以是表达式外,还可以是别名
但WHERE后面只能是表达式!!
3. 排序字段中支持单个字段,多个字段,函
SQL数据库结构化语言通常包括DQL(查询),DML(操纵),DPL(处理),DCL(控制),DDL(定义或描述语言),CCL(指针控制)数据定义语句**定义模式**: CREATE SCHEMA TEXT AUTHORIZATION ZHANG
**外码**: FOREIGN KEY (Sno)REFERENCES Student(Sno)//满足参照完整性
**设置搜索路径
一. MySql初始化1.配置环境变量,目录为bin下2.新建my.ini在根目录下 [mysqld]
basedir=D:Environmentmysql-5.7.29
datadir=D:Environmentmysql-5.7.29data
port=3306
skip-grant-tables #因为第一次运行需要忽略用户名和密码 初始化完需要把这行语句注释掉 3.管理员模式启动C
1、MYSQL公共表表达式(CTE):理解:公用表表达式是一个命名的临时结果集,仅在单个SQL语句(例如SELECT,INSERT,UPDATE或DELETE)的执行范围内存在。语法:WITH 公用表名 (column_list) AS ( // column_list涉及到的列名(可选) 查询语句)SELECT * FROM 公用表名;或WITH cte_name (column_list) A
三种关系: 多对多 ; 多对一 ; 一对一 . 找出俩张表之间的关系 分析步骤:
#1、先站在左表的角度去找
是否左表的多条记录可以对应右表的一条记录,如果是,则证明左表的一个字段foreign key 右表一个字段(通常是id)
#2、再站在右表的角度去找
是否右表的多条记录可以对应左表的一条记录,如果是,则证明右表的一个字段foreign key 左表一个字段(通常是id
hive分层结构hive分层结构是根据不同的业务需求而设计的。目前主流的就两种设计三层结构ODS层:临时存储层,一般来说是对企业中所产生的数据采集过来做临时存储,对数据源系统做解耦合,为下一步分析做准备DW层:数据仓库层,数据加工与整合DA层:数据应用层,提供产品和数据分析所使用的数据四层结构ODS层:临时存储层,一般来说是对企业中所产生的数据采集过来做临时存储,对数据源系统做解耦合,为下一步分析
转载
2023-08-30 11:54:51
109阅读
很适合入门的一本SQL书,虽相见已晚,但看完了,总要记录点什么。DESC关键字只应用到直接位于其前面的列名。如果想在多个列上进行降序排序,必须对每一列指定DESC关键字。与DESC相对的是ASC,实际上,ASC没有多大用处,因为升序是默认的。在一个列不包含值的时候,称其包含空值NULL。NULL:无值,它与字段包含0,、空字符串或仅仅包含空格不同。确定值是否为NULL,不能简单地检查是否=NULL
# Python描述表格
## 介绍
在Python中,我们经常需要处理和操作表格数据。表格是一种结构化的数据形式,通常由行和列组成,用于存储和展示大量的数据。在本文中,我们将讨论如何使用Python来描述和操作表格数据。
## Pandas库
Pandas是一个优秀的Python数据分析库,提供了丰富的函数和工具来处理表格数据。它基于NumPy库构建,可以高效地处理大规模数据集。
首先
1.注意DESC关键字仅适用于在它前面的列名(birth);不影响species列的排序顺序。SELECT name, species, birth FROM pet ORDER BY species, birth DESC; ---desc只影响birth.先按照species升序列排序,species值相同的再按照birth降序排序 2.日期计算MySQL提供了几个函数,可以用来
而Oracle默认分配的为8K,也就是对应于32768M左右的空间大小,如果想继续增大表空间的话,只需要通过alter tablespace name add datafile ‘path/file_name‘ size 1024M;添加数据文件的方式就可以了。数据块是oracle中最小的空间分配单位,各种操作的数据就的放在这里,oracle从磁盘读写的也是块。一旦create database,